Which countries can you visit with Schengen Visa

Schengen Visa holder can visit 76 countries include Sao Tome and Principe, Gibraltar, Malta, Egypt, and Spain. Having a Schengen Visa can make it easier to travel to other countries that accept Schengen Visa without the need for additional visas or paperwork.

Which Schengen Visa are eligible?

The Schengen Visa that are typically eligible for visa exemption to certain countries include following which allows for travel through Schengen to another country.

  • Short-term C-Type Schengen visa
  • Long-term D-Type Schengen visa
  • Transit A-Type Schengen visa
  • Schengen Residence permit

It's important to note, however, that visa exemption policies can vary by country and may be subject to change at any time, so it's always best to check the specific visa requirements for each country you plan to visit before you travel. Additionally, having a valid Schengen Visa does not guarantee entry into a visa-exempt country, as border officials have the right to deny entry to anyone they deem ineligible or suspicious.
